I'd ask readers to note that slavery is illegal in the United States and much of the world today, yet it still exists in different forms. But it seems slavery was only banned for Greeks, and they still had Barbarian slaves. So it seems that there were at least some enlightened rulers, but they were not 100% effective (much like modern times, ).Īnother place to look is this WIkiepedia article where they speak about it happening in Greece in about 600 BC. The Hongwu Emperor sought to abolish all forms of slavery but in practice, slavery continued through the Ming dynasty. In that same wikipedia article, another prominent example is that during the Ming Dynasty: Slavery was reinstated in AD 12 before his assassination in AD 23.

In the year AD 9, the Emperor Wang Mang usurped the Chinese throne and instituted a series of sweeping reforms, including the abolition of slavery and radical land reform. Seems like the other answers are late by at least a thousand years - China did it around the beginning of the common era.

Dubrovnik the city state had never participated in the slave trade, but this decision went further. The very next day the vote and the decision came into effect and slavery was banned. At a meeting of the Grand Chamber of the Republic of Dubrovnik on the 27th of January 1416 a total of 75 councillors of 78 in the council voted to ban slavery in the Republic. On the 27th of January 1416, the Republic of Ragusa (Dubrovnik) banned the slave trade.
